The new blanks will offer 2 styles of blanks. One style is a new composite blank that is strong and light and available in three size jigging models. The blanks are made here in the USA and will be 5' 6". They will be around $100 for the blank and built rods will range from $225-$300 depending on components and style of build. Secondly there is a new series of jigging and popping blanks that are the creme of the crop and will compete with the highest of manufacturers out there. The blanks will be around $200-$300 depending on model. They are made over seas by composite tubing in NZ and Australia with one of the leading engineers using carbon and kevlar laminates. These rods built will be in the $500-$700 range depending on style and components.

The other news is we are changing our business model. There are no more factory built production rods. We are building every rod for the customer as the orders come in. Each rod will be semi custom and built here by either me or one of my employees. There will be no outsourcing of any kind, no sub contractors, etc. All built rods will be inspected by me personally. With this said we are now going factory direct. There will be a very limited amount of dealers if any at all. We are doing this to keep the cost down and and quality.

Other advantages to this style of rod building is now the customer will be able to decide on exactly what rod they want within limits. You will be able to chose what guides you want, what colors, what type of reel seat, etc. Like I said each rod will be semi custom. We are even upgrading our rod finishes and epoxies used for reel seats and gimbals. Each rod will get only the best materials for the job. We will even offer a variety of butt wraps for the customer that want the fancy look.
